Description

Volume of book seals machine and integrates discharge mechanism
Technical Field
The utility model relates to a volume seals machine technical field, specifically is a volume seals machine and integrates discharge mechanism.
Background
The book-sealing machine is equipment for binding books into books, is used very frequently in a printing factory, and greatly improves the speed of binding the books and the production efficiency of enterprises compared with the prior art. At present, when a book is bound into a book by using a book-binding machine, a discharging mechanism of the book-binding machine is not perfect, so that the book flowing out of the machine is randomly stacked in a collecting bin. Therefore, when an operator needs to collect bound books, the operator needs to spend time for arranging the books, and time is wasted, so that if the booklet sealing machine discharging mechanism capable of enabling the books to be placed orderly is designed, the production efficiency of an enterprise is greatly improved, and the labor intensity of workers is invisibly reduced.

Drawings
FIG. 1 is a schematic structural view of the present invention;
FIG. 2 is a schematic view of the structure of the integration box of the present invention;
fig. 3 is a cross-sectional view taken at a-a in fig. 2.
In the figure: 1. a booklet-sealing machine body; 2. a discharge hopper; 21. discharging the material belt; 22. a material blocking inclined plate; 23. a drive motor; 3. an integration box; 31. a material clamping plate; 32. a cylinder; 33. a telescopic column; 34. a material containing platform; 35. sliding the push plate; 36. a pull rod; 37. a rolling wheel; 38. a notch; 39. and (4) rolling a rod.

Example (b): referring to fig. 1, an integrated discharging mechanism for a book-binding machine comprises a book-binding machine body 1, a discharging hopper 2 is fixedly arranged on one side of the front face of the book-binding machine body 1, a discharging belt 21 for conveying books is arranged inside the discharging hopper 2, an integrating box 3 for arranging the books is arranged below the discharging hopper 2, the integrating box 3 is of a box body structure with an open top, and material clamping plates 31 for clamping and aligning two sides of the books are arranged on two sides in the integrating box 3; the discharge hopper 2 is fixedly connected with the booklet-sealing machine body 1, the discharge belt 21 inside the discharge hopper 2 is used for conveying bound books, and the principle of the discharge belt 21 is similar to that of a conveyor belt.
The two sides in the discharge hopper 2 are respectively provided with a material blocking inclined plate 22, the outer wall of the discharge hopper 2 is fixedly provided with a driving motor 23 for controlling the operation of the discharge belt 21, the material blocking inclined plates 22 are positioned above the discharge belt 21, and the material blocking inclined plates 22 are fixedly connected with the inner wall of the discharge hopper 2 and are used for limiting the discharge position of the book; the material blocking inclined plates 22 are symmetrically distributed about the discharge hopper 2, and are used for discharging books in the middle as shown in fig. 1, so that the book sorting device is convenient for the integrating box 3 to sort the books.
Referring to fig. 2, the cylinders 32 are fixedly disposed on both sides of the outside of the integration box 3, and piston rods of the cylinders 32 penetrate through the side walls of the integration box 3 and are fixedly connected to the material clamping plate 31; the cylinder 32 is used for controlling the movement of the material clamping plate 31, so that books are clamped, the books which are randomly piled are tidied, and in the specific using process, the clamping amplitude of the cylinder 32 is adjusted along with the width of the books, so that the books are prevented from being damaged by clamping.
Two sides in the integrated box 3 are respectively provided with a telescopic column 33, each telescopic column 33 is composed of two pipe bodies which are mutually sleeved, one end of each telescopic column 33 is fixedly connected with the inner wall of the integrated box 3, and the other end of each telescopic column 33 is fixedly connected with the side wall of the material clamping plate 31; the function of the telescopic mechanism is to limit the position of the material clamping plates 31, and as shown in fig. 2, four telescopic columns 33 are connected to each material clamping plate 31.
Referring to fig. 3, a notch 38 is formed in the inner bottom surface of the integrating box 3 along the length direction of the integrating box 3, a material holding platform 34 for holding books is embedded in the notch 38, the material holding platform 34 is in a concave plate-shaped structure, the length of the material holding platform is greater than that of the integrating box 3, and a rolling wheel 37 is arranged on the bottom surface of one end of the material holding platform located outside the integrating box 3; the filling platform 34 can be drawn and slid along the notch 38, and the rolling wheels 37 are contacted with the ground.
A sliding push plate 35 for integrating books is arranged inside the material containing platform 34, a pull rod 36 penetrates through one end of the material containing platform 34, which is positioned outside the integrating box 3, and one end of the pull rod 36, which faces the sliding push plate 35, is fixedly connected with the sliding push plate 35; the length direction of the pull rod 36 is parallel to the length direction of the integration box 3, so that the user can control the sliding push plate 35 to move through the pull rod 36, thereby pushing the book.
The inner side wall of the notch 38 is rotatably connected with a plurality of roller rods 39 which are uniformly distributed, and the rolling surfaces of the roller rods 39 are tangent to the bottom surface of the material containing platform 34; the roller 39 is used to reduce the friction resistance of the material containing table 34 during movement, so as to facilitate the drawing of the material containing table 34.
The working principle is as follows: in the use process of the utility model, firstly, bound books enter the integration box 3 from the discharge hopper 2 under the conveying action of the discharge belt 21, the material clamping plates 31 are arranged on two sides inside the integration box 3, the inner bottom surface of the integration box 3 is connected with the material containing platform 34 in a sliding way, wherein the material clamping plates 31 can be driven by the air cylinder 32, and the two material clamping plates 32 move inwards simultaneously to stack the loose books so as to align the two sides of the books; in addition, the material containing platform 34 is provided with a sliding push plate 35 and a pull rod 36, and an operator can control the position of the sliding push plate 35 through the pull rod 36, so that the sliding push plate 35 is attached to stacked books, and the books are further integrated. To sum up, the utility model discloses utilize and press from both sides the length both sides that the flitch 31 made books and align, utilize the width both sides that the push pedal 35 made books that slide to align. Finally, will hold material platform 34 and outwards stimulate, then take out books, compare traditional technology, the arrangement process of books is convenient and fast more in this practicality, has practiced thrift operating time greatly, has improved work efficiency.
